Where is Lloyd Gaines?

Lloyd Lionel Gaines was the plaintiff in Gaines v. Canada, one of the most important early court cases in the 20th-century U.S. civil rights movement, later he would go missing never to be seen again.

Who was the Real Cherokee Bill?

Crawford Goldsby was a 19th-century American outlaw, known by the alias Cherokee Bill.

Who are the Scottsboro Nine?

The Scottsboro Boys were nine black teenagers falsely accused of raping two white women aboard a train near Scottsboro, Alabama, in 1931.
